Blue Jays News
The Toronto Blue Jays dropped a tough one to the New York Yankees, losing 3-8 and putting a damper on their recent surge. Despite a strong offensive showing in games prior, marked by a 4-3 win yesterday, the team now finds itself precariously close to the playoff line, just half a game out of a Wild Card spot. Jose Soriano struggled in his last outing, unable to maintain control past the sixth inning as his pitch count climbed to 93. However, the Blue Jays can take solace in the continued growth of Dylan Cease, who is beginning to find his footing and showed promise amidst the current no-hit drought that stretches back 36 years. As they prepare for tomorrow's matchup, every game is a must-win as the playoffs loom on the horizon.
